Soil biota in an ungrazed grassland: response to annual grass (Bromus tectorum) invasion

Belnap J and Phillips SL. 2001. Soil biota in an ungrazed grassland: response to annual grass (Bromus tectorum) invasion. Ecological Applications. 11(5):1261-1275

Bromus tectorum is an exotic annual grass that currently dominates many western U.S. semi-arid ecosystems. The effects of this grass on ecosystems in general and soil biota specifically are unknown. This study compared the soil food-web structure of two native grassland associations (Stipa and Hilaria) with and without the presence of Bromus tectorum. The study was conducted in Canyonlands National Park in southeastern Utah. Data was collected from three grassland sites: Virginia Park, Chesler Park and Squaw Flat. Sites were sampled in spring 1996 for vascular and non-vascular vegetation, soil chemistry, bacteria, soil fungi, protozoa and invertebrates. Live and dead plant-infecting fungi were sampled in spring and fall 1997. Soil biota in Hilaria-Bromus generally responded to the Bromus invasion in an opposite manner than in Stipa-Bromus, e.g. if a given component of the food web increased in one community, it generally decreased in the other. When compared to non-invaded sites, soil and soil food-web characteristics of the newly invaded sites included, 1) lower species richness and lower absolute numbers of fungi and invertebrates, 2) greater abundance of active bacteria, 3) similar species of bacteria and fungi as those found in soils invaded over 50 years ago, 4) higher levels of silt, thus greater fertility and soil water-holding capacity, 5) a more continuous cover of living and dead plant material thus facilitating the germination of the large-seeded Bromus. The results illustrate that 1) soil food-web structure can vary widely within what would generally be considered one vegetation type (semi-arid grassland) and, 2) addition of a common resource can evoke disparate responses from individual food-web compartments depending on their original structure.
